PADUCAH – The Cave-in-Rock Ferry is temporarily closed due to high winds.

The ferry halted service about 10:10 a.m.

Winds were out of the west-southwest at 29 miles per hour with gusts to 45 mph. From that direction, the wind interacts with current in the Ohio River to create hazardous conditions. The National Weather Service has issued a wind advisory through 3 p.m., CST, today. Winds are expected to continue to be gusty into the evening hours.
